1

France Visa

News Discuss 
Planning a journey to France's enchanting landscapes and vibrant culture? Securing the correct visa is a vital first move. This guide delivers a extensive look at the visa for France application system, covering https://barryjeod086904.blogoscience.com/46317275/visa-for-france

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story